Smart Home Installation Cost Overview in Grand Rapids

The cost of smart home installation in Grand Rapids, Michigan, typically falls between $450 to $5,400 per project, with an average of $1,800. This range reflects the specific market conditions and project scope within the Midwest region. The costs can vary significantly based on factors such as the size of your home, the complexity of the installation, the types of materials used, and local labor rates.

When considering a smart home upgrade in Grand Rapids, it's important to factor in additional expenses like permits, especially if you're altering existing wiring or adding new infrastructure. The season can also impact costs; winter months might see higher charges due to inclement weather making installation more challenging.

Factors That Affect Smart Home Installation Cost in Grand Rapids

The cost of smart home installations in Grand Rapids is influenced by several key factors:

  • Materials: High-quality materials, such as advanced sensors and state-of-the-art security systems, will naturally increase the overall cost. Local suppliers may also affect pricing.
  • Labor: The complexity of your project, including whether it requires electrical work or integration with existing systems, can significantly impact labor costs. Skilled installers are often more expensive but ensure a professional setup and future-proofing.
  • Size: Larger homes may require additional sensors, cameras, and other devices, thus increasing the total cost.
  • Complexity: Smart home systems that involve extensive customization or integration with multiple devices will be more expensive than simpler setups. Professional designers can help optimize your system for both aesthetics and functionality.
  • Seasons and Permits: Installation during colder months might incur additional costs due to weather-related delays, and obtaining necessary permits can add another layer of expense. Always check with local authorities to understand the permit requirements specific to your project.

Tips to Save Money on Smart Home Installation in Grand Rapids

Pro Tip

Always get at least 3 quotes from licensed contractors in Grand Rapids before starting your project. Comparing bids can save you 10–30% on smart home installation costs.

To save money on smart home installations in Grand Rapids, consider these practical tips:

  • Research Providers: Compare quotes from several reputable companies and ask for detailed breakdowns of their pricing. This transparency can help you find the best value.
  • Optimize Your Needs: Work with a smart home consultant to assess your specific needs and avoid over-customization. Tailoring your system to meet only essential requirements can save money while still providing significant benefits.
  • Take Advantage of Sales and Discounts: Keep an eye on sales, particularly around the holiday season when many companies offer discounts or bundle deals that can reduce overall costs.
  • Consider DIY Solutions: For basic installations like smart lighting or thermostats, you might be able to save money by purchasing devices online and installing them yourself. However, this approach requires technical know-how.
